HTC Announces Tattoo, Android Handset

HTC Corporation has introduced the HTC Tattoo another Android-based phone that brings broad personalization to the masses. The company’s idea is that with its ‘distinct’ design and ability to personalize all aspects the phone people will be able to express themselves and create their own individual mobile experience. "Everyone wants their own phone to feel like it was specifically made for them. The Tattoo, with HTC Sense represents an easy way to shape your own distinct mobile experience and really make it your own," said Peter Chou, Chief Executive Officer, HTC Corporation. "The HTC Tattoo ensures that you can create the most engaging and appropriate mobile experience through simple yet powerful personalization." HTC Tattoo is the second phone to embody HTC Sense, a mobile experience focused on putting people at the centre by making your phone work in a more simple and natural way. Designed by listening and observing how people live and communicate, HTC Sense revolves around three fundamental principles Make it Mine, Stay Close and Discover the Unexpected, like the Hero. The stylish HTC Tattoo is small and compact, fitting snugly into your hand or pocket. People will also be able to design and purchase their own unique covers or search and select from popular cover designs, altering the look of the phone to reflect their mood or individual tastes. HTC Tattoo integrates Google’s innovative mobile services including: Google Maps, search, Google Mail, and Android market where users can download applications and games.
